    There is a lot of hype around digital media today: 184 million bloggers (and counting)... 350 million Facebook members (and counting)... 1.2 billion YouTube video streams daily (and counting)... 4 billion mobile phone subscribers globally (and counting). The hype can lead to confusion, and confusion can lead to inertia.

    Companies cannot afford to be idle in this new landscape. The newspapers, magazines and TV networks on which we've depended so long don't have the same impact. The 24-hour news cycle is dead. Consumers increasingly turn to search engines, social media and their peers for information and advice. As a result, companies must change the way they communicate with them.
